For Accepted Students Congratulations! EVMS is a wonderful school, with fantastic faculty and staff and with students who really want to help each other out. The administration at EVMS are absolutely fabulous and they are completely open to any and all concerns. We have a great curriculum and are one of a handful of MD schools in the United States that incorporate ultrasound training into the education system. The extracurricular activities at EVMS are really nice too. We have a student-run clinic (the HOPES clinic) which serves to provide healthcare to people who have none. We also have students who volunteer their time and energy in providing food/assistance to the needy of Norfolk, VA and many more! For Wait-listed Students Have hope! I know a lot of WL students are on the fence as to what they should do, but be aware that if you're wait-listed now, that means you were probably interviewed early (that's a good thing! 😉). Just do yourself a favor, and send in an update email every once in a while listing your new activities or other things that you are continuing to do. Also include a reason as to why you'd like to attend EVMS as well in this email too. Admin offices definitely like students who show interest in their school (this applies to every school, not just EVMS).

Here is my story: I am a OOS non-traditional student who did the Georgetown SMP. I sent in my primary application sometime towards the end of June and was considered "complete" (with grades, LOR, secondaries) by the beginning of August. I interviewed in early November and was subsequently wait-listed a few weeks later. Sometime towards the tail end of May, I was accepted. Trust me, this is a long, drawn-out process. I had to wait about 6 months after my WL decision before I heard back, but in the mean time, I was sending in updates whenever I had something new to add to my file. I let the school know about my new tutoring experiences, volunteer experiences as well as new shadowing that I had done. So please, keep the school posted of what you're doing (activities, grades, shadowing, etc) and please be patient (sounds pretty hard to do, and trust me, I know how it feels).
